Roy Northway PASH

Regimental number157
Date of birth21 March 1895
Place of birthAdelaide, South Australia
SchoolNorthway, Flinders Street Public School, Adelaide, South Australia
ReligionChurch of England
OccupationMachinist
AddressSwaine Avenue, Rose Park, South Australia
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ation19
Next of kinFather, Frederick William Pash, Swaine Avenue, Rose Park, South Australia
Enlistment date10 February 1915
Date of enlistment from Nominal Roll12 February 1915
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name27th Battalion, A Company
AWM Embarkation Roll number23/44/1
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Adelaide, South Australia, on board HMAT A2 Geelong on 31 May 1915
Rank from Nominal RollLance Corporal
Unit from Nominal Roll27th Battalion
FateReturned to Australia 25 August 1917
Discharge date--/01/1918
Family/military connectionsBrother: 6874 Pte Stanley Richard PASH, 48th Bn, returned to Australia, 18 January 1919.
Other detailsWar service: Egypt, Gallipoli, France, Belgium. Wounded, Lagnicourt, March 1917; invalided to No 3 General Hospital, Oxford, England; recovered.
